ICE Officer Fatally Shoots Colombian Man in Maine; Vehicle Stops Temporarily Suspended

Analysed 14 Jul 2026·20 sources analysed·Biddeford, Maine, United States·Politics
ICE Officer Fatally Shoots Colombian Man in Maine; Vehicle Stops Temporarily SuspendedPreviousNext

A 26-year-old Colombian man, Joan Sebastian Guerrero, was fatally shot by a U.S. Immigration and Customs Enforcement (ICE) officer during an enforcement operation in Biddeford, Maine. Authorities said the man was not the intended target and was shot after allegedly attempting to flee and use his vehicle as a weapon. The officer involved has been placed on administrative leave, and investigations by the FBI and Maine Attorney General's office are ongoing. Following this and a similar shooting in Texas, ICE has temporarily suspended most vehicle stops to review procedures amid public protests and calls for transparency.
